And that actually reminded me of this African proverb about elephants that I read years ago. And it talks about that when elephants are babies, their legs are tied down into pegs, into the ground with a rope.
And as babies, they're too weak to break free from the rope and peg that's in the ground. But as they become adults, they grow strong, right? Think of the elephants. They're some of the biggest creatures. They grow strong, and at some point they are strong enough to snap that rope in a second in an instant.
Yet many of them never do. And not because they're not strong enough, but because they believe they're not strong enough. They believe that they are bound. So they live as if they are bound. And to be honest with you, that can be us.
[00:05:00] Sometimes the fears, the expectations of others, our self-doubt, they shouldn't be strong enough to hold us, but sometimes we allow it to be. We can sometimes stay in a cage because we think we can't move, not because we actually can't move, but we allow some of these fears and these doubts and these expectations to paralyze us.

Is it fear of who you may lose in that decision or choice? Maybe it's fear of what lies on the other side, the fear of the unknown, and let's make it real because some of these cages are financial cages, right?
We wanna keep it a hundred. Some of these cages we put ourself in because of financial stressors, fear of leaving a job that no longer serve us because the paycheck feels safe, right? The paycheck feels safer than your peace. You don't wanna get rid of that six figure salary, even though it's robbing you of your peace and joy.
It could be fear of investing, even though deep [00:07:00] down, you know, your money needs to be growing far faster than it's growing now, but the fear of possibly losing your money is keeping you stuck. So you're essentially leaving money on the table because you don't wanna lose money. The fear of saying no to financial obligations that drain you because you don't wanna disappoint others.
So you may loan out money to people that you know you're never gonna get it back from. you may go places with people, spend your money on different things and you don't even wanna be there. Right? Accepting invitations where you need to spend your hard earned money and you don't even wanna be there.
So here's the thing, freedom. It may cost you relationships, it may cost you titles. It could even cost you your comfort, but it's only temporarily because at the end of the day, if it's costing you your peace, then it's too [00:08:00] expensive. So friends, let's move into that segment where it's your aligned move of the week, which is a simple, powerful action you could take to bring your money, mindset, and life into deeper alignment. Because let's face it, listening is great, right? Listening is good.
It's always good to plug into a good podcast. But alignment happens when you take action. Alignment happens when you move, when you apply what you've heard. So here it is. I want you to write down some moments where you felt truly free in your life,
and then I want you to write down what about those moments made you feel free. What was it? Was it because you didn't have the responsibilities that you normally have? Was it because you didn't have a care in the [00:10:00] world? Was it because you did what you wanted to do and you didn't have to think about how anybody else felt about it?
I want you to write down. What about those moments made you feel free?
And then I want you to write down what's one thing that you could do now in this present season to express that freedom again and again and again. I want you to feel freedom all the time, not just in your finances, but in your life. So write down what you can do now to feel that way, and don't just write it, schedule it.
Whatever it is that you can do, schedule it. Treat it like it's important. Treat it like it's the most important meeting. On your calendar, just the way that you would schedule anything else on your calendar, doctor's appointments, appointments for your kids, things that you really need to remember.[00:11:00]
You really need to remember this so schedule it, prioritize it, because freedom compounds, but it only compounds if you do it daily. The more and more you choose you and you choose these freeing task, the more and more you're gonna get used to being free.
